What is Fuel report? How do i generate a Fuel report?

Fuel Report
Track fuel consumption across your fleet and tie that in with actual expenses at the pump through our fuel card integration. Investigate potential fuel savings with our nearest-cheapest fuel finder using the FuelSaver package. Also, See information on fuelling events (increase/decrease by at least 30% in fuel level) and the address where this event happened.

To Generate a Fuel Report: 

1. Log in to the Azuga Web application.

2. Navigate to the Fuel page, under the Reports tab.

3. Using the date picker, select a time frame. (Date range should be 93 days or less.)

4. Select Fuel Report or Fuel Location Exception Report or Fuel Quantity Exception Report to run report by.

5. Select the Groups/Vehicles you want to include in the report.

6. Select a Drivers tag from Drop down

7. Click Generate Report.

To export the Report in PDF or XLSX format to your system, click the Export button.

Note: This report can be scheduled to run at regular intervals. This will automatically generate the report and send it to you via email. For more information on scheduling a report, see section https://fleet-azuga.helpscoutdocs.com/article/450-how-to-schedule-a-report
